    Collector's Choice Comics is my go-to comic shop whenever I'm in the Tempe area. The store is…read morealways well stocked with both new releases and back issues, and it's the only shop I've found that consistently carries a large inventory of Spawn back issues, including several key issues. I've checked out other comic shops around the Valley, but none of them seem to have the Spawn selection that Collector's Choice does. They also have a great selection of graded comics and variants, which makes browsing even more fun. One thing to know before visiting: new releases and back issues are handled as separate transactions. So if you bring a mixed stack to the counter, expect to do one transaction for the new books and another for the back issues. I've never asked why they do it that way, but after shopping here several times, it's just something I expect. The staff has always been friendly and welcoming. During my last visit, the owner was interacting with customers by offering 25% off any item in the store to anyone who could correctly answer his random comic trivia question. Nobody got it right while I was there, but it was a really fun way to engage with customers. For the curious, the question was: "What was the final issue of Conan the Barbarian published by Marvel?" Answer: #275. If you're a comic collector--especially a Spawn fan--this place is absolutely worth checking out.
